On-tap 7/14/2015 at Brutopia, in Cranston, RI served in a mug glass.
A: The beer is a murky pinkish amber color, with a thin white head that fades quickly and leaves a thin lace on the glass.
S: The aroma contains a lot of watermelon, some lager yeast, light caramelized malts and a very faint touch of hops.
T: The taste starts out with a strong watermelon sweetness. Then some mild breadiness comes in from lager yeast and a thin malt character. The hops presence is very mild but brings a decent balance. The after-taste is sweet.
M: A little crisp and a little smooth but a bit watery, light-to-medium body, medium carbonation, finish is slightly sticky.
O: Flavorful, goes down ok, not too filling, mild kick, good representation of style, it’s not a bad beer for its role as a light fruity alternative.
